linux选择调用套接字编程

时间:2012-04-04 11:17:47

标签: c sockets select

在大多数Unix系统中,键入ctrl-d表示标准输入上的EOF。键入会发生什么 ctrl-d到程序被阻止在调用中选择?这里选择是参考C中基于事件的Socket编程。

select(maxfd+1, &readfds, NULL, NULL, NULL);

1 个答案:

答案 0 :(得分:0)

如果文件描述符已关闭,则select将返回并指示文件描述符已准备好被读取。后续读取将返回0,表示文件结束条件。